The Evolution of Slot Machine Technology

Slot machines have come a long way since their inception in the late 19th century. Over the years, advancements in technology have transformed the slot gaming experience, making it more interactive, immersive, and accessible. Let’s explore the evolution of slot machine technology and the impact it has had on the gaming industry.

The mechanical slot machines of the past consisted of physical reels with symbols and a lever to initiate the spins. These machines relied on intricate mechanisms and gears to determine the outcomes. However, the introduction of electronic components in the 1960s revolutionized the industry. Electronic slot machines replaced the physical reels with virtual ones displayed on a screen, making the gameplay more dynamic and flexible.

The next significant leap in slot machine technology came with the introduction of video slots in the 1970s. Video slots utilized video screens and computer graphics to display the reels and symbols, opening up a whole new world of possibilities for game developers. Video slots allowed for more complex game themes, bonus features, and interactive gameplay elements, enhancing the entertainment value and engagement for players.

The rise of the internet and online casinos in the late 1990s paved the way for another major technological advancement in slot gaming. Online slots brought the casino experience directly to players’ homes, eliminating the need for physical machines. Players could access a vast selection of slot games from their computers, laptops, and later, mobile devices. This accessibility and convenience revolutionized the industry, allowing players to enjoy their favorite slots anytime and anywhere.

The integration of random number generator (RNG) technology further improved the fairness and randomness of slot games. RNGs ensure that each spin’s outcome is independent and unbiased, providing a level playing field for players. The advancements in graphics and animation technology have also played a significant role in enhancing the slot gaming experience. High-definition graphics, intricate animations, and visually stunning effects create immersive and captivating gameplay environments. Themes range from traditional fruit machines to fantasy worlds, ancient civilizations, and popular movies or TV shows. The visual appeal adds to the overall entertainment value and draws players into the gaming experience.

Furthermore, the integration of touch screen technology in mobile devices has made slot gaming even more interactive and intuitive. Players can now directly interact with the game by tapping and swiping on the screen, providing a more engaging and tactile experience.

In recent years, the emergence of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ies has introduced a new dimension to slot gaming. VR slots transport players into virtual worlds where they can explore immersive environments and interact with the game elements in a more realistic and engaging manner. AR slots blend the virtual and physical worlds, overlaying digital elements onto the player’s real-world environment.
